.blog-post-listing{column-gap:16px;display:grid;grid-template-columns:1fr 1fr 1fr;position:relative;row-gap:24px}.blog-post-listing article{background:linear-gradient(92deg,hsla(0,0%,100%,.15) -4.01%,hsla(0,0%,100%,.05) 105.18%)}.blog-post-listing article .article-body{padding:48px 24px 0!important;position:relative}.blog-post-listing .readmore-button{align-items:center;background:#00c7bb;border-radius:50%;display:flex;justify-content:center;padding:8px;position:absolute;right:16px;top:-10px;transform:translateY(-50%);transition:box-shadow .3s ease}.blog-post-listing .readmore-button:hover{box-shadow:0 0 12px 0 rgba(217,85,120,.5)}.blog-post-listing .post-title{color:var(--Neutrals-N-8,#fff);font-size:24px;font-style:normal;font-weight:600;line-height:36px;transition:color .3s ease}.blog-post-listing .post-title:hover{color:#cc1c4a}.blog-post-listing .p-3{color:var(--Turquoise-TQ-100,#2fc2bb);font-size:14px;font-style:normal;font-weight:400;line-height:20px;margin:16px 0 24px}.blog-post-listing .p-3 p{color:rgba(255,255,242,.8);font-size:18px!important;font-style:normal!important;font-weight:400!important;line-height:28px!important;margin:0}@media only screen and (max-width:1100px){.blog-post-listing{grid-template-columns:1fr 1fr}.blog-post-listing .p-3 p{font-size:16px!important;line-height:1.625rem!important}}@media only screen and (max-width:770px){.blog-post-listing{grid-template-columns:1fr;row-gap:40px}}